21 Axis deceleration ramps
DANGER
Serious injuries caused by moving axes!
The deceleration ramps of the AX5000 servo drive are purely functional and not suitable
for personal protection purposes!
A fault in the drive system may have the following effects:
- it may not be possible to enable the functional deceleration ramps;
- it may not be possible to bring the axes to a standstill.
In other words, the axes may not respond. This could cause serious injury.
Before commissioning ensure that all external personal protection measures were applied.
The AX5000 servo drive has functional deceleration ramps, which brake or coast down the connected
motors in the event of fault.
Both ramps are configured via the parameters:
S-0-0372 (Drive Halt Acceleration Bipolar) and
S-0-0429 (Emergency Stop Deceleration).
When configuring the parameters, the braking energy balance of the whole system has to be taken into
account. Mechanical and electrical limits affect the maximum deceleration.
Electrical limits result from:
the available current
The torque available for braking the axes depends on the maximum current limit. This determines the
shortest possible deceleration time.
the capturing of regenerative energy (generated during braking)
The energy is initially captured by the DC link. When this is saturated, energy is fed to the internal or
external brake resistors. The capacity of the internal and/or external brake resistors indicates for how
long the energy returned from the DC link can be converted to heat. This increases the deceleration
time.
Testing the deceleration ramps
During operation the deceleration ramps are activated automatically in the event of an error reaction of the
drive system. To assess these processes, it is necessary to trigger and test the functional ramps manually
during commissioning.
Proceed as follows:
Parameter S-0-0327 (Drive Halt Acceleration Bipolar)
Trigger the manual process via bit 14 „Enable Drive“ in parameter S-0-0134 (master control word).
Parameter S-0-0429 (Emergency Stop Deceleration)
Trigger the manual process via parameter P-0-0310 (error reaction verification)
"Force error reaction: Closed loop ramp".
